Restaurant week for KC Originals

Posted by Owen Morris on Mon, Feb 23, 2009 at 10:30 AM

click to enlarge restaurant_dining.jpg
In addition to Mardi Gras, Fat Tuesday and Pancake Day (more on that tomorrow) this week brings us the KC Originals Restaurant Week. The 40 restaurants in the organization range from upscale, such as Aixois and Tatsu's, to working-man bars like Harry's Country Club.

From now until Saturday, every restaurant in the group offers 20 percent off on all dinners to people signed up for the KC Originals rewards card. (The card is much less cheesy than the name "rewards card" makes it sound.) The card is free and can be picked up at any KC Original restaurant.

If you're not on the e-mail list or don't have time to pick up the card, get on the e-mail list, print the 20 percent off certificate and go back out to eat, the certificate is also posted on the KC Originals Web site. There's no reason not to save money when visiting a local restaurant this week.

As well as offering a discount, restaurant week is also getting into the spirit of other events, celebrating Mardi Gras with menu and

cocktail specials.
